Description | Overeaters Anonymous (OA) is a twelve step program for individuals who are recovering from compulsive overeating. The concept of abstinence is the basis of OA's program of recovery. OA offers the newcomer support in dealing with both the physical and emotional symptoms of compulsive overeating. The only requirement for OA membership is a desire stop eating compulsively. |
